Unveiling Software: An Introduction to its Inner Workings

Software, the invisible force driving our digital world, often feels like a puzzle. But understanding its inner workings doesn't require a certification in computer science. At its core, software is a set of instructions that tell a computer what to do. These instructions are written in codes that humans can understand, and they form the basis of everything from simple calculators to complex software.
